Understanding Obesity Beyond Calories
Obesity is not simply caused by overeating. It is often influenced by:
● Insulin resistance
● Chronic inflammation
● Hormonal imbalance (thyroid, cortisol, leptin)
● Emotional eating
● Poor sleep patterns
● Sedentary lifestyle
● Digestive dysfunction
● Toxin accumulation
Naturopathy identifies these root causes instead of focusing only on calorie restriction.

Hormonal & Stress Regulation
Chronic stress increases cortisol levels, which promotes abdominal fat storage. Naturopathy
integrates:
● Yoga therapy
● Pranayama (breathing techniques)
● Guided meditation
● Relaxation therapies
Stress correction is often the missing link in long-term weight management.

    Gut Health Optimization
    Emerging research shows gut microbiota plays a key role in obesity. Naturopathic programs
    include:
    ● Natural probiotics
    ● Fiber-rich foods
    ● Digestive-support herbs
    ● Reduction of inflammatory foods

    Improved gut health enhances nutrient absorption and metabolic efficiency.

    Can Naturopathy Help With Genetic Obesity?
    Yes — while genetics may influence body type, lifestyle and metabolic correction significantly impact weight regulation. Naturopathy works on optimizing internal health so that genetic predisposition does not fully determine outcomes.

    Is It Safe to Continue Medications?
    Yes. A responsible naturopathic program works alongside conventional treatment. Any reduction in medication should only happen under medical supervision.
